This is it - the calm before the storm. The students at Hogwarts are hanging on to the hope that they can retain a little normalcy, even though it seems clear that everyone knows & fears what is about to come. The Ministry is beginning to crumble, scrambling to put back the pieces of the already-broken bureaucracy that seems to only be getting worse each day. The death eaters are gloating, their new rise to power is imminent, there are just a few more key pieces that need to fall into place.
The school is running under the (often, mysteriously absent) Albus Dumbledore. The changes from canon throughout the school are as follows:
Professor Larkin: This is your most-of-the-time Care of Magical Creatures professor. He is a sharp, sarcastic man, though genuinely friendly, & truly liked by his students. He takes on just over half of the classes, while Rubeus Hagrid takes on the rest. Previously, he was a member of the Department for the Control & Regulation of Magical Creatures at the Ministry of Magic, but stepped down from his position after his wife's death a few years past. He came out of his pseudo-retirement & decided to teach.
The Ghost of the Quidditch Pitch: Almost no one has seen him, & those who claim to have seen him are usually not believed by their fellow classmates, though, if you head out into the grounds past curfew on an evening of desirable weather, you may see a ghostly figure head out from the forest & spend some time haunting the quidditch pitch. The only member of staff who could possibly get rid of the rumours by giving them a verdict would be Dumbledore, and well, good luck finding him around the school, these days.

The Ministry is under the loose-handed control of Rufus Scrimgeour. There are different employees all over the place as they try to fill the gaps of missing employees & employees that simply fled from their stations, paperwork flying in the breeze behind them. The changes from canon throughout the Ministry are as follows:
Broderick Bode: He's not dead. This doesn't really change the story, to be perfectly honest, we just needed a few more Unspeakables.

The Death Eaters could not be happier. Under strict orders, many of the lower-rank & less-trusted men & women of this alliance are often travelling about to recruit even more members, take out impure families at a time, & spread the word. Some of the more trusted members are busy with more important pieces of the puzzle, such as Draco Malfoy, Bellatrix Lestrange, Severus Snape, and many others.The changes from canon throughout the Death Eaters are as follows:
The Lestranges: Bellatrix & Rodolphus Lestrange are parents to two children, Tiffany & Soleus. You can read Tiffany's history here & Soleus' here for more details. This does not affect their storylines in any major ways.
